East Meadow Village, NY demographics:
population, income, and more
East Meadow population
How many people live in East Meadow
East Meadow is home to 36,821 residents, according to the most recent Census data. Gender-wise, 46.8% of East Meadow locals are male, and 53.2% are female.
Age demographics
The median age in East Meadow is 43, with the population distributed as follows: about 16.8% are children under 15, then 11.7% are in the 15 to 24 age group. Adults between 25 and 44 make up 24.1% of the population, while another 25.7% fall into the 45 to 64 bracket. Finally, around 21.8% are 65 or older.
Racial makeup
In East Meadow, 78.3% of the population are US-born citizens, while 17% have gained naturalized citizenship. At the same time, 4.7% of residents are non-citizens. As for race, 61.4% of locals are Caucasian, 4.6% are African American and 19.2% have Asian roots. There’s also a share of 6.7% that includes residents with two or more races.
Households in East Meadow
A peek inside East Meadow households
East Meadow has 11,796 households, with an average of 3 members in each. Of these, 78.3% are families, while the remaining 21.7% are made up of individuals living alone or with non-relatives, such as roommates.

Housing in East Meadow
The housing landscape of East Meadow
East Meadow's housing consists of 12,240 units, with 81.3% being detached single-family homes ideal for those wanting space. Attached options, including duplexes and townhouses, make up 3.7% and offer a more compact, shared living style.
The age of buildings in East Meadow
In East Meadow, the median construction year is 1957. About 3% of homes were built before the 1940s, with another 9.4% going up by 1949. Most development happened in the second half of the 20th century. Then, 3.4% of homes were added from 2000 to 2009, 3.2% between 2010 and 2019, and 1.2% are part of the newest wave of development.
East Meadow occupancy rates
Out of the 11,796 occupied housing units in East Meadow, 89.4% are owner-occupied, while 10.6% are lived in by tenants. Meanwhile, 3.6% of all homes on the local market sit vacant.
East Meadow housing costs
Housing costs in East Meadow come to a median of $2,415 per month, while tenants specifically pay a median gross rent of $2,890.
Education in East Meadow
East Meadow education at a glance
About 29.6% of the population in East Meadow went to high school, while 13.4% pursued college studies. Another 9% earned an associate degree and 25.8% hold a bachelor’s. Meanwhile, 19.8% went even further, earning a master’s or doctorate.
Income in East Meadow
How much people earn in East Meadow
The average annual household income in East Meadow was $167,941 in 2024, the most recent annual data available, according to the U.S. Census Bureau. This marked a +7.2% change from the previous year. At the same time, the median income stood at $133,971, reflecting a +4% shift over the same period.
East Meadow income by age
In East Meadow, households led by residents aged 25 to 44 — usually in the early to mid stages of their careers — have a median income of $169,483. Those with someone between 45 and 64 in charge, often well established professionally, earn $184,021 overall. Younger households, where the main provider is under 25 and just starting out, report a median income of $67,002, while those led by someone over 65, many of whom may be retired, have about $72,479 in earnings. Overall, 93.9% of the locals in this community live above the poverty line.
Average renter income in East Meadow
To get a better sense of what renters earn on average in East Meadow, their median household income was $68,472 according to 2022 Census data. In addition, the rent-to-income ratio in the area, at 50.6%, shows what portion of their earnings goes toward housing expenses.
Employment in East Meadow
Workforce and job types in East Meadow
The job market in East Meadow is powered by 16,492 working residents, spread across a range of industries and roles. 87.8% of the working population are employed in professional or administrative positions, while 12.2% are in hands-on or service-based jobs. Also, 9.7% run their own businesses, 62% are employed by private companies, and 20.1% work in the public sector.
Workforce demographics
Available workforce
The unemployment rate in East Meadow stands at 4.8%, representing the share of the workforce currently without a job and actively looking for one.
Transportation in East Meadow
How people get around in East Meadow
In East Meadow, the average commute time is 35 minutes. Commuting methods vary: 73.5% of residents travel by personal vehicle and 2.3% prefer to walk, while the remaining share relies on public transit or on two wheelers to get from A to B.

Data source & methodology
The demographic data on this page was sourced from the latest U.S. Census Bureau release—the 2019–2023 American Community Survey (ACS) 5-year estimates.
The information, issued annually, is compiled and published by the Point2Homes Research Team as soon as new data becomes available.
